What stimulus are animals responding to if they hibernate?
omeli [17]

Answer:

Animals respond to Environmental stimulus if they hibernate.

Explanation:

A stimulus is any change in the  environment that affects the activity of an organism or what causes an animal to act in a certain way.

Hibernation is an innate behavior.  It is a resting state that helps animals survive the winter.  

During hibernation a warm-blooded animal like a ground squirrel slows down its heart rate and breathing rate.

Animals may respond to environmental stimuli through behaviors that include hibernation, migration, defense, and courtship.
